정보
요청한 주제가 아래에 표시됩니다. 그러나 이 주제는 이 라이브러리에 포함되지 않습니다.
이 항목은 아직 평가되지 않았습니다.- 이 항목 평가

StorageFile.Properties | properties Property

파일의 콘텐츠 관련 속성에 대한 액세스를 제공하는 개체를 가져옵니다.

구문


var properties = storageFile.properties;

속성 값

유형: StorageItemContentProperties

파일의 콘텐츠 관련 속성에 대한 액세스를 제공하는 개체입니다.

설명

참고  Microsoft Word와 같은 다른 앱으로 정의된 속성 처리기를 사용하여 가져오거나 설정한 속성에는 액세스할 수 없습니다. 대신, 시스템 인덱스의 지원을 받는 파일 쿼리를 사용하여 이러한 속성을 가져올 수 있습니다. 자세한 내용은 QueryOptions을 참조하십시오.

속성에 액세스하는 방법에 대한 추가 코드 샘플을 보려면 파일 액세스 샘플을 참조하십시오.

Windows Phone 8

이 API는 구현되어 있지 않으므로 호출할 경우 예외가 throw됩니다. Windows Phone 런타임 API를 참조하십시오.

예제

이 예제에서는 StorageFile.Properties를 사용하여 파일에서 콘텐츠 속성이나 지정된 속성을 검색하는 방법을 보여 줍니다.



var file = SdkSample.sampleFile;
if (file !== null) {
    var outputDiv = document.getElementById("output");

    // Get image properties
    file.properties.getImagePropertiesAsync().then(function (imageProperties) {
        outputDiv.innerHTML += "Date taken: " + imageProperties.dateTaken + "<br />";
        outputDiv.innerHTML += "Rating: " + imageProperties.rating + "<br />";

        // Specify more properties to retrieve
        var dateAccessedProperty = "System.DateAccessed";
        var fileOwnerProperty    = "System.FileOwner";

        // Get the specified properties through storageFile.properties
        return file.properties.retrievePropertiesAsync([fileOwnerProperty, dateAccessedProperty]);
    }).done(function (extraProperties) {
        var propValue = extraProperties[dateAccessedProperty];
        if (propValue !== null) {
            outputDiv.innerHTML += "Date accessed: " + propValue + "<br />";
        }
        propValue = extraProperties[fileOwnerProperty];
        if (propValue !== null) {
            outputDiv.innerHTML += "File owner: " + propValue;
        }
    },
    // Handle errors with an error function
	   function (error) {
	       // Handle errors encountered while retrieving properties
    });
}

GetImagePropertiesAsync가 완료된 후 imagePropertiesImageProperties 개체를 가져옵니다. 또한 RetrievePropertiesAsync가 완료된 후 extraProperties는 지정된 속성이 포함된 개체를 가져옵니다.

이 예제에서는 file에 속성을 검색할 파일을 나타내는 StorageFile이 포함되어 있습니다.

요구 사항

지원되는 최소 클라이언트

Windows 8

지원되는 최소 서버

Windows Server 2012

지원되는 최소 전화

Windows Phone 8[구현되지 않음, 설명 참조]

네임스페이스

Windows.Storage
Windows::Storage [C++]

메타데이터

Windows.winmd

참고 항목

StorageFile

 

 

이 정보가 도움이 되었습니까?
(1500자 남음)
의견을 주셔서 감사합니다.
표시:
© 2014 Microsoft. All rights reserved.